I just recently started having my car ('05 GT/105K) shift a little rougher in lower gears, usually only first to second. I checked my fluid level and saw that it was a little low. Once I added fluid the problem went away. A day later and the problem returned, checked fluid, a little low, added fluid, problem went away, no spots on driveway. Same thing happened the next day. No evidence of a leak anywhere. I have had to put in about 2 quarts over the last week or so to keep it running smooth. Everywhere I park there are no stains and the trans is dry on all external areas.

Anyone else experience this or know what may be causing it?

Thanks for any help,
Tom
 


check your radiator for the fluid to be in the coolant. the coolers break inside the rad.

if this is the case, stop driving it, as if coolant gets back into the trans its over johnny.
 
It may be only leaking when you're driving down the road. I would suspect cooling line seals at the transmission or input shaft seals.
